日本免费高清视频-国产福利视频导航-黄色在线播放国产-天天操天天操天天操天天操|www.shdianci.com

學無先后,達者為師

網站首頁 編程語言 正文

Minio設置文件鏈接永久有效的完整步驟_其它綜合

作者:御劍長歌 ? 更新時間: 2022-09-06 編程語言

前言

minio分享文件的鏈接,最多支持分享七天

通過 MinIO客戶端 管理存儲桶策略的方式實現文件鏈接永久有效

1.下載MinIO Client

采用 Docker 方式 安裝

拉取Docker穩定版鏡像

docker pull minio/mc

2.運行MinIO Client

docker run -it --entrypoint=/bin/sh minio/mc

成功提示

3.添加一個云存儲服務

mc config host add <ALIAS> <YOUR-S3-ENDPOINT> <YOUR-ACCESS-KEY> <YOUR-SECRET-KEY> [--api API-SIGNATURE]

示例-MinIO云存儲

從MinIO服務獲得URL、access key和secret key。

mc config host add minio http://192.168.1.51 BKIKJAA5BMMU2RHO6IBB V7f1CwQqAcwo80UEIJEjc5gVQUSSx5ohQ9GSrr12 --api s3v4

別名就是給你的云存儲服務起了一個短點的外號。S3 endpoint,access key和secret key是你的云存儲服務提供的。API簽名是可選參數,默認情況下,它被設置為"S3v4"。

4.驗證

查詢所有的存儲桶

mc ls minio

ps:這里的 minio 是剛剛取的別名

5.policy命令 - 管理存儲桶策略

通過 mc policy 命令 獲取 policy 相關的所有命令

mc policy

查看存儲桶或路徑策略

mc policy get minio/mybucket/myphotos/2020/

設置存儲桶或路徑策略為 download

mc policy set download play/mybucket/myphotos/2020/

download 后面 跟存儲桶或路徑

minio地址 + 文件路徑 就成為了永久可訪問的鏈接,注意如果直接在控制臺中復制url,其中的minio要去掉。

注意: 這里強烈建議設置路徑的策略為 download 這樣 所屬存儲桶的策略就變為了 custom
如果直接將 bucket 設置為 download 那么就可以進入到minio客戶端,雖然只能看到 設置了相應策略的 bocket ,但是匿名者可以在其中隨意的創建與刪除文件!

參考地址 MinIO 官網

總結

原文鏈接:https://blog.csdn.net/weixin_40392053/article/details/119451698

欄目分類
最近更新